Xiu Song is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Materials Chemistry and Aerospace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Xiu Song has authored 52 papers receiving a total of 717 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 40 papers in Mechanical Engineering, 29 papers in Materials Chemistry and 12 papers in Aerospace Engineering. Recurrent topics in Xiu Song’s work include High Temperature Alloys and Creep (21 papers), Titanium Alloys Microstructure and Properties (10 papers) and Intermetallics and Advanced Alloy Properties (8 papers). Xiu Song is often cited by papers focused on High Temperature Alloys and Creep (21 papers), Titanium Alloys Microstructure and Properties (10 papers) and Intermetallics and Advanced Alloy Properties (8 papers). Xiu Song collaborates with scholars based in China, Japan and Mexico. Xiu Song's co-authors include Masaaki Nakai and Mitsuo Niinomi and has published in prestigious journals such as Materials Science and Engineering A, Journal of Materials Science and Corrosion Science.
